NEMA 23 stepper servo motor: This frame size 57-112mm NEMA 23 closed loop stepper motor, equipped with a 1000cpr incremental optical encoder, has a rated current of 4.6A and a holding torque of 3.0Nm and a keyway shaft type. It offers higher accuracy, higher output torque, higher speed, lower motor heating, lower power consumption, and faster response to drive controllers compared to open loop stepper motors. NEMA 23 stepper servo motor Specification

- Part Number: 57AI112EC-1000
Step Angle: 1.8deg
Bipolar/Unipolar: Bipolar
Holding Torque: 3.0Nm
Rated Current/phase: 4.6A
Driving Voltage: 24-48VDC
Frame Size: 57x57mm
Body Length: 135mm
Shaft Diameter: Φ8mm
Shaft Length: 21mm
Keyway Length: 15mm
Encoder Type: Incremental Optical
Encoder Resolution: 1000CPR
A small tip:
A servo motor is a type of electric motor that is designed to rotate a shaft to a specific angle with high precision. Unlike a regular DC motor, which simply spins when voltage is applied, a servo motor can be controlled to turn to a specific position and hold it there.

Motor 4 Leads Connection: A+(Black), A-(Green); B+(Red), B-(Blue)
Encoder 6 Leads Connection: A+(Black), A-(Blue); B+(Yellow), B-(Green), 5V(Red), GND((White)
